Reports To: Management
Job Summary: The Digital Retail Sales Advisor, under the direction of management, will manage online customer interactions, ensure seamless digital processes, and contribute to overall sales performance by handling lead overflow and monitoring critical sales data.
Job Duties:
- Digital Lead Management: Manage and oversee 180+ day buckets and overflow from Digital Salespeople. Address lead overflow of 150+ leads (2 Digital Salespeople) or 225+ leads (3 Digital Salespeople), ensuring prompt and professional follow-up. Direct any appointments from leads taken to Non-Digital Salespeople as per standard procedure.
- Call Monitoring and Logging: Listen to all phone bucket recordings to ensure calls are appropriately logged and categorized. Identify discrepancies and ensure accurate documentation of all customer interactions.
- BDC Reporting: Responsible for generating and maintaining all Digital BDC reports, providing insights and recommendations to improve performance. Track and report lead conversion rates, appointment show rates, and overall digital engagement.
- Customer Engagement: Respond to online inquiries and provide exceptional customer service throughout the digital retail process. Guide customers through online vehicle selection, financing options, and trade-in evaluations.
- Collaboration and Support: Work closely with Sales Managers to align digital processes with overall dealership goals.
